rsync via ssh : fichiers ouliés ???

17 réponses
Avatar
Une Bévue
je fais un rsync, via ssh, entre mon portable dell sous Xubuntu 11.10 /
Voyager et mon iMac sous Lion latest.

la commande :
rsync -a --delete-after --exclude '.gvfs' -e ssh ${SRC} ${CMP}:${DST}

avec :
SRC=/home/yt
CMP=yt@[<adresse IPV6 de l'iMac>]
et
DST=/Users/yt/Downloads/Dell

sur le dell, j'ai les fichiers suivants :
yt@D620 ~ % lal Téléchargements
total 1652624
drwxr-xr-x 2 yt yt 4096 2012-01-03 08:32 .
drwxr-xr-x 69 yt yt 4096 2012-01-03 08:40 ..
-rw-r--r-- 1 yt yt 4542781 2011-12-06 15:19 FreeGo4.5.zip
-rw-rw-r-- 1 yt yt 1111773184 2012-01-03 08:20
linuxmint-201109-xfce-dvd-64bit.iso
-rw-r--r-- 1 yt yt 104054 2011-12-06 11:03 m3u4radiotray.zip
-rw-r--r-- 1 yt yt 26112 2011-12-06 11:01 Nikon NX2 Product Key.doc

au "début" de la sauvegarde, je vois, sur mon iMac, les fichiers suivants :
FreeGo4.5.zip
Nikon NX2 Product Key.doc
et donc ni FreeGo ni linuxmint.

à la fin, je me retrouve avec le répertoire "Téléchargements" VIDE côté
iMac :
yt@D620 ~ % ssh yt@iMac
Last login: Mon Jan 2 19:35:21 2012 from dell-par
imyt% ls -al Downloads/Dell/yt/Téléchargements
total 0
drwxr-xr-x 2 yt staff 68 3 jan 00:46 .
drwxr-xr-x 92 yt staff 3128 3 jan 07:26 ..
imyt%

Pourquoi ?


je précise que, si je fais un backup sur un disk externe, avec la commande :
rsync -az --delete-after --exclude '.gvfs' ${SRC} ${DST}
donc SANS ssh et avec :
SRC=/home/yt
et
DST=/media/DD

ça marche impec :yt@D620 ~ % lal /media/DD/yt/Téléchargements
total 1945344
drwxr-xr-x 2 yt yt 4096 2012-01-03 08:44 .
drwxr-xr-x 68 yt yt 4096 2012-01-03 08:50 ..
-rw-rw-r-- 1 yt yt 875560960 2012-01-03 08:44
debian-live-6.0.3-amd64-xfce-desktop.img
-rw-r--r-- 1 yt yt 4542781 2011-12-06 15:19 FreeGo4.5.zip
-rw-rw-r-- 1 yt yt 1111773184 2012-01-03 08:20
linuxmint-201109-xfce-dvd-64bit.iso
-rw-r--r-- 1 yt yt 104054 2011-12-06 11:03 m3u4radiotray.zip
-rw-r--r-- 1 yt yt 26112 2011-12-06 11:01 Nikon NX2 Product Key.doc
yt@D620 ~ %

10 réponses

1 2
Avatar
Gérald Niel
Salut,

Juste une question, le rapport avec la programation sous Mac OS X ?
Je redirige vers fr.comp.os.unix.

Le Mardi 03 janvier 2012 à 09:22 UTC, Une Bévue écrivait sur
fr.comp.sys.mac.programmation :
je fais un rsync, via ssh, entre mon portable dell sous Xubuntu 11.10 /
Voyager et mon iMac sous Lion latest.

la commande :
rsync -a --delete-after --exclude '.gvfs' -e ssh ${SRC} ${CMP}:${DST}

avec :
SRC=/home/yt
CMP=yt@[<adresse IPV6 de l'iMac>]
et
DST=/Users/yt/Downloads/Dell

sur le dell, j'ai les fichiers suivants :
~ % lal Téléchargements
total 1652624
drwxr-xr-x 2 yt yt 4096 2012-01-03 08:32 .
drwxr-xr-x 69 yt yt 4096 2012-01-03 08:40 ..
-rw-r--r-- 1 yt yt 4542781 2011-12-06 15:19 FreeGo4.5.zip
-rw-rw-r-- 1 yt yt 1111773184 2012-01-03 08:20
linuxmint-201109-xfce-dvd-64bit.iso
-rw-r--r-- 1 yt yt 104054 2011-12-06 11:03 m3u4radiotray.zip
-rw-r--r-- 1 yt yt 26112 2011-12-06 11:01 Nikon NX2 Product Key.doc

au "début" de la sauvegarde, je vois, sur mon iMac, les fichiers suivants :
FreeGo4.5.zip
Nikon NX2 Product Key.doc
et donc ni FreeGo ni linuxmint.

à la fin, je me retrouve avec le répertoire "Téléchargements" VIDE côté
iMac :
~ % ssh
Last login: Mon Jan 2 19:35:21 2012 from dell-par
imyt% ls -al Downloads/Dell/yt/Téléchargements
total 0
drwxr-xr-x 2 yt staff 68 3 jan 00:46 .
drwxr-xr-x 92 yt staff 3128 3 jan 07:26 ..
imyt%

Pourquoi ?


je précise que, si je fais un backup sur un disk externe, avec la commande :
rsync -az --delete-after --exclude '.gvfs' ${SRC} ${DST}
donc SANS ssh et avec :
SRC=/home/yt
et
DST=/media/DD

ça marche impec : ~ % lal /media/DD/yt/Téléchargements
total 1945344
drwxr-xr-x 2 yt yt 4096 2012-01-03 08:44 .
drwxr-xr-x 68 yt yt 4096 2012-01-03 08:50 ..
-rw-rw-r-- 1 yt yt 875560960 2012-01-03 08:44
debian-live-6.0.3-amd64-xfce-desktop.img
-rw-r--r-- 1 yt yt 4542781 2011-12-06 15:19 FreeGo4.5.zip
-rw-rw-r-- 1 yt yt 1111773184 2012-01-03 08:20
linuxmint-201109-xfce-dvd-64bit.iso
-rw-r--r-- 1 yt yt 104054 2011-12-06 11:03 m3u4radiotray.zip
-rw-r--r-- 1 yt yt 26112 2011-12-06 11:01 Nikon NX2 Product Key.doc
~ %







--
On ne le dira jamais assez, l'anarchisme, c'est l'ordre sans le
gouvernement ; c'est la paix sans la violence. C'est le contraire
précisément de tout ce qu'on lui reproche, soit par ignorance, soit
par mauvaise foi. -+- Hem Day -+-
Avatar
unbewusst.sein
Gérald Niel <gerald.niel+ wrote:

Juste une question, le rapport avec la programation sous Mac OS X ?
Je redirige vers fr.comp.os.unix.



Euh, écrire un script zsh pour alimenter un serveur sous Mac OS X
(spécificité de l'encodage UTF8) n'est pas de "la programation sous Mac
OS X" certe mais de la programation POUR Mac OS X...

D'ailleurs il m'a été répondu sur Mac OS X...
--
« Doutez de tout et surtout de ce que je vais vous dire. »
(Bouddha)
Avatar
pehache
Le 05/01/12 08:26, Une Bévue a écrit :
Gérald Niel<gerald.niel+ wrote:

Juste une question, le rapport avec la programation sous Mac OS X ?
Je redirige vers fr.comp.os.unix.



Euh, écrire un script zsh



Le post initial ne parle pas de script zsh.

Et même si il en parlait, ça n'a rien de spécifique Mac

pour alimenter un serveur sous Mac OS X
(spécificité de l'encodage UTF8)



Le post initial ne parle pas d'UTF8

n'est pas de "la programation sous Mac
OS X" certe mais de la programation POUR Mac OS X...



Le groupe fcsmp est fait pour la programmation *spécifique* à Mac OS X.
Or je ne vois pas ce que la question avait de spécifique à Mac OS X.
rsync est un outil unix d'une manière générale.

D'ailleurs il m'a été répondu sur Mac OS X...



Ce qui est très fort, vu que le post initial n'était pas publié sur fcom-ox
Avatar
Une Bévue
Le 08/01/2012 01:16, pehache a écrit :
Ce qui est très fort, vu que le post initial n'était pas publié sur fcom-ox



formé chez les barbus ?
Avatar
Paul Gaborit
À (at) Sun, 08 Jan 2012 01:16:16 +0100,
pehache écrivait (wrote):

Le groupe fcsmp est fait pour la programmation *spécifique* à Mac OS
X. Or je ne vois pas ce que la question avait de spécifique à Mac OS
X. rsync est un outil unix d'une manière générale.



Ce n'est pas parce que vous ne voyez pas que ça n'existe pas... Ici, la
spécificité liée à Mac OS X était la manière dont les noms de fichiers
sont codés en UTF-8 dans un système de fichiers HFS+.

--
Paul Gaborit - <http://perso.mines-albi.fr/~gaborit/>
Avatar
pehache
Le 08/01/12 10:21, Paul Gaborit a écrit :

À (at) Sun, 08 Jan 2012 01:16:16 +0100,
pehache écrivait (wrote):

Le groupe fcsmp est fait pour la programmation *spécifique* à Mac OS
X. Or je ne vois pas ce que la question avait de spécifique à Mac OS
X. rsync est un outil unix d'une manière générale.



Ce n'est pas parce que vous ne voyez pas que ça n'existe pas... Ici, la
spécificité liée à Mac OS X était la manière dont les noms de fichiers
sont codés en UTF-8 dans un système de fichiers HFS+.




Désolé, mais j'ai beau relire le post initial
(<news:4f02c8de$0$14898$), je ne vois nulle
référence à une histoire d'UTF-8

Et même si il s'agissait d'UTF-8 dans un système de fichiers HFS+, je ne
vois pas bien en quoi ce serait un problème de programmation.
Avatar
pehache
Le 08/01/12 06:36, Une Bévue a écrit :
Le 08/01/2012 01:16, pehache a écrit :
Ce qui est très fort, vu que le post initial n'était pas publié sur
fcom-ox



formé chez les barbus ?



Il faut être barbu pour poster au bon endroit ?
Avatar
Paul Gaborit
À (at) Sun, 08 Jan 2012 19:34:44 +0100,
pehache écrivait (wrote):


Et même si il s'agissait d'UTF-8 dans un système de fichiers HFS+, je
ne vois pas bien en quoi ce serait un problème de programmation.




Depuis quand les questions de codage ne font-elles plus partie du monde
de la programmation ?

--
Paul Gaborit - <http://perso.mines-albi.fr/~gaborit/>
Avatar
pehache
Le 08/01/12 23:17, Paul Gaborit a écrit :

À (at) Sun, 08 Jan 2012 19:34:44 +0100,
pehache écrivait (wrote):


Et même si il s'agissait d'UTF-8 dans un système de fichiers HFS+, je
ne vois pas bien en quoi ce serait un problème de programmation.




Depuis quand les questions de codage ne font-elles plus partie du monde
de la programmation ?




Les questions de codage des noms de fichiers dans un système de fichiers
sont, à la base, indépendantes du contexte "programmation" ou "pas
programmation".
Avatar
Paul Gaborit
À (at) Mon, 09 Jan 2012 09:01:55 +0100,
pehache écrivait (wrote):

Le 08/01/12 23:17, Paul Gaborit a écrit :

À (at) Sun, 08 Jan 2012 19:34:44 +0100,
pehache écrivait (wrote):


Et même si il s'agissait d'UTF-8 dans un système de fichiers HFS+, je
ne vois pas bien en quoi ce serait un problème de programmation.




Depuis quand les questions de codage ne font-elles plus partie du monde
de la programmation ?




Les questions de codage des noms de fichiers dans un système de
fichiers sont, à la base, indépendantes du contexte "programmation" ou
"pas programmation".




Ne tombez pas dans le piège qui consiste à croire qu'il existe une
frontière entre donnée et programme. Les questions de codage font
intégralement partie des questions de programmation.

--
Paul Gaborit - <http://perso.mines-albi.fr/~gaborit/>
1 2